Electronic Configuration and Molecular Behaviour
We predict the distribution of electrons in these molecular orbitals by filling the orbitals in the same way that we fill atomic orbitals, by using the Aufbau principle. Lower-energy orbitals fill first, electrons spread out among degenerate orbitals before pairing, and each orbital can hold a maximum of two electrons with opposite spins. Just as we write electron configurations for atoms, we can write the molecular electronic configuration by listing the orbitals with superscripts indicating the number of electrons present. For clarity, we place parentheses around molecular orbitals with the same energy. In this case, each orbital is at a different energy, so parentheses separate each orbital.
For example, the electronic configuration of O2 molecule is given below:
Thus, the electronic configuration of O2 molecule can be written as:
σ1s2 σ*1s2 σ2s2 σ*2s2 σ2pz2 π2px2 π2py2 π*2px1 π*2py1
